Paper, a rapidly growing design canvas for teams building with agents, is seeking its first operations hire following a $34 million Series A led by Accel and ICONIQ. The company reports having grown ARR 25-fold after launching Paper Desktop, with revenue increasing more than 20% month over month and thousands of paying teams, including Ramp, Lovable, and Harvey. Reporting to the Head of Product Growth, the hire will establish business-data reporting, build the go-to-market systems architecture, oversee financial, payments, people, and back-office processes, and automate operational work across product, billing, and customer workflows. Candidates should bring early-stage startup operations or analytics experience, technical fluency with APIs, integrations, automation, and data models, commercial judgment, and an ability to independently implement practical systems. Within six months, the role is expected to deliver trusted reporting, connected product and GTM signals, streamlined back-office operations, and reduced infrastructure work for the growth team. Paper offers a fully remote environment, optional San Francisco headquarters, flexible work arrangements, equipment support, annual team gatherings, and meaningful equity within its 12-person team.

Paper, a growing remote design-tool startup backed by investors including Accel, Basecase, and ICONIQ, is hiring a principal-level Design Engineer to help build a fast, collaborative product for designers. The role requires a recognized track record in both design and engineering, with expertise in creating complex UI features, browser and DOM behavior, fine interaction design, minimal-library development, and performance optimization toward a 120 fps target. The 12-person company emphasizes ownership, high shipping velocity, continuous critique and improvement, and willingness to contribute beyond formal responsibilities. It offers flexible hours, equipment funding, meaningful equity, a fully remote international team, and an annual in-person gathering. The application process includes resume review, two short interviews, and either a take-home assignment or a one-to-two-week paid trial in which candidates ship a feature while collaborating through Slack and GitHub.
